| Hello to all who may be also searching for our ancestors. I'm looking for families with the surname Labay, La Bay or Labe. Charles Labe came to the US around 1866 and married Lucinda Paige/Page. Charles was from Canada and I first find him in the 1880 census in Cear River, MI. Lucinda's father was Augustus Page and he came from Lisbon, Saint Lawrence New York. Lucinda was born in Mass. Augustus was here in 1860 at least. His brother Moses and father David travel here and are found in the 1860 census of Brown County. Chas and Lucinda had 14 children, 12 in which made it to Adulthood. They continue to live in the Menominee/Cedar River area most of their married lives. Lucinda had 1/2 siblings Milo and Albert Montgomery. Lucinda's mom Lovina was married between 1854 and 1858. She married Augustus in Jan 7, 1860. Lucinda siblings married, some of the surnames are Bolan, Emery, and Williams. Any relatives are free to e-mail and ask questions. We also have branches with surnames of Barr, Hakes, Wellman, Pronteau. |
